Company Second Logo in all Report Layouts

This module allows businesses to include a second company logo in all default PDF reports generated by Odoo. This feature is useful for companies that wish to present dual branding or display multiple logos for different departments or subsidiaries.

Key Features

Dual Branding Easily add a second logo to represent different brands, departments, or subsidiaries within your organization, enhancing brand visibility. Include a second company logo to represent different aspects of your business.
Automatic Integration The second logo is automatically included in all default PDF report templates, such as invoices, sales orders, delivery slips, and quotations, ensuring consistency across all documents.
Multi-Company Support Ideal for businesses operating under multiple company names. You can configure different logos for each company profile within Odoo.
User-Friendly Interface: Intuitive settings in the Odoo backend allow non-technical users to upload and manage logos without needing to modify any code.

Configuration

Settings -> General Settings -> Configure Document Layout.
